VB历次理论题整理

合集下载
  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

一、单项选择题(每题1分,共4分)

1、msgbox函数的返回值是()。

A 数值 B字符

C 布尔值 D货币型

2、在算术运算符 +、-、*、^,/,\,MOD中,优先级排第四的是()。

A /

B \

C *

D MOD

3、在VB中取子串函数是()函数。

A Left()

B Right()

C Mid()

D Str()

4、双精度的数据类型的定义符为()。

A %

B !

C #

D &

二、判断题,请在括号内打或打(每空1分,共3分)

1、VB开发环境提供了的三种模式为设计模式,运行模式和中断模式。()。

2、PRINT inta=inta+1语名的“=”号是赋值号。()。

3、在VB中表达式 12 & “ABC”的值为“12ABC”。()。

三、下列程序段的功能是找出水仙花数并输出。请在横线内填空把程序补充完整。(每空1分,共3分)DIM I AS INTEGER,A AS INTEGER,B AS INTEGER,C AS INTEGER

S=0

FOR I=100 TO 999

A=___________________

B=I \10 MOD 10

C= __________________

IF____________________________________THEN PRINT I

NEXT I

一、选择题

1、以下不属于Visual Basic系统的文件类型是()

(A).frm (B).bat (C).vbg (D).vbp

2、程序运行后,在窗体上单击鼠标,此时窗体不会接收的事件是()

(A)MouseDown (B)MouseUp (C)Load (D)Click

3、如果要改变窗体的标题,则需要设置的属性是()

(A)Caption (B)Name (C)Backcolor (D)BorderStyle

4、以下叙述错误的是()

(A) 在KeyPress事件过程中不能识别键盘的按下与释放

(B) 在KeyPress事件过程中不能识别回车键

(C)在KeyDown和KeyUp事件过程中,将键盘输入的”A”和”a”视作相同的字母

(D)在KeyDown和KeyUp事件过程中,从大键盘输入的”1”和右侧小键盘上输入”1”被视作不同的字母

5、设窗体上有一个列表框控件List1,含有若干列表项。以下能表示当前被选中的列表项内容的是()

(A) List1.list (B)list1.listIndex (C)list1.Text (D)Lixt1.Index

6、如果一个工程含有多个窗体及标准模块,则以下叙述中错误的是()

(A)如果工程中含有Sub Main过程,则程序一定首先执行该过程

(B)不能把标准模块设置为启动模块

(C)用Hide方法只是隐藏一个窗体,不能在内存中清除该窗体

(D任何时刻最多只有一个窗体是活动窗体

7、VB中称对象的数据为()

(A) 属性 (B) 方法 (C) 事件 (D) 封装

8、下列可作为VisuslBasic变量名的是()

(A)A#A (B)4A (C)?xY (D)conslA

9、以下叙述中错误的是()

(A)打开一个工程文件时,系统自动装入该工程有关的窗体、标准模块等文件

(B)保存Visual Basic程序时,应分别保存窗体文件及工程文件

(C) Visual Basic应用程序只能以解释方式执行

(D)事件可以由用户引发,也可以由系统引发

10、如果要在菜单中添加一个分隔线,则应将其Caption属性设置为()

(A)= (B)* (C)% (D)-

2011 年模拟三

一、单项选择题(每题1分,共4分)

1、根据变量的作用域,可以将变量分为三类,它们是()。

A 局部变量、窗体/模块变量和标准变量

B 局部变量、窗体/模块变量、全局变量

C 局部变量、模块变量和窗体变量 D局部变量、标准变量和全局变量

2、在INPUTBOX函数的参数中必选参数是()。

A 输入框的标题

B 提示信息

C 默认值

D 输入框的位置

3、参数传送过程中,使用关键字_____来修饰参数,可以使之按地址传递。()。

A ByRef

B ByVal

C Value

D Refernce

4、为了用计时器控件每钞产生5个事件,应该把其Interval属性设置为()。

A 10

B 50

C 100

D 200

二、判断题,请在括号内打或打(每空1分,共3分)

1、VB的赋值语句只能给变量赋值。()

2、命令按钮仅能识别鼠标单击事件。()

3、将焦点主动设置到指定的控件或窗体上应该采用SetFocus方法。()

三、在窗体上有一个名称Command1的命令按钮,用于计算s=5+1/2!+1/3!+1/4!+……+1/n!。请在横线内填空把程序补充完整。(每空1分,共3分)

DIM S AS Double,I AS INTEGER,p AS Integer

S=_______ :n=5

FOR I=

P=1

For j=1 to i

p=

next

相关文档
最新文档